Ситуация, когда бухгалтеру необходимо произвести возврат излишне выплаченной зарплаты, встречается в практике многих предприятий. Ошибки при начислении, технические сбои или неверный ввод данных могут привести к тому, что сотрудник получит на руки сумму больше положенной. В системе 1С:Зарплата и управление персоналом (ЗУП 3.1) этот процесс требует внимательного подхода, так как напрямую влияет на налоговую отчетность и расчеты с персоналом.

Первое, что нужно сделать при обнаружении переплаты — определить природу ошибки. Если сумма была выплачена ошибочно из-за счетной ошибки или технической неисправности, законодательство позволяет требовать ее возврата. Однако механизм отражения этой операции в программе 1С ЗУП зависит от того, был ли уже закрыт период, проведен ли расчет НДФЛ и перечислены ли деньги в бюджет.

В данном материале мы подробно разберем алгоритмы действий для различных сценариев: от простого удержания из следующей выплаты до полного сторнирования документов прошлого периода. Вы узнаете, какие документы использовать, как корректировать налоговые регистры и избежать дублирования выплат в учете.

Анализ причин переплаты и выбор метода исправления

Прежде чем приступать к техническим действиям в программе, необходимо юридически и бухгалтерски обосновать метод возврата. В 1С:ЗУП нет одной универсальной кнопки «Вернуть зарплату», поэтому выбор инструмента зависит от статуса периода. Если месяц еще не закрыт, а ведомость не проведена окончательно, ситуация решается проще всего.

В случаях, когда период закрыт и сдана отчетность, потребуется использование документов корректировки. Важно понимать, что просто создать документ поступления денег от сотрудника недостаточно — нужно, чтобы эта сумма корректно отразилась в регистрах накопления и взаиморасчетов. Неправильный выбор метода может привести к тому, что в следующем месяце сотруднику вновь начислят лишнее или неверно рассчитается налог.

Существует три основных сценария работы с переплатой:

  • 🔍 Ошибка обнаружена до проведения ведомости на выплату — требуется пересчет начислений.
  • 💸 Ошибка обнаружена после выплаты, но в том же расчетном периоде — возможно удержание из следующей зарплаты.
  • 📉 Ошибка обнаружена в следующем периоде или году — необходимо сторнирование и корректировка НДФЛ.

⚠️ Внимание: Согласно Трудовому кодексу, удержание из зарплаты возможно только с письменного согласия сотрудника, если переплата не связана со счетной ошибкой. В противном случае возврат оформляется добровольным внесением наличных или безналичным переводом.

📊 Как вы обнаружили переплату?
При сверке с банком
При сдаче отчетности
Жалоба сотрудника
Плановая проверка

Корректировка в текущем расчетном периоде

Если излишняя выплата произошла в рамках текущего месяца, который еще не закрыт для расчетов, алгоритм действий в 1С ЗУП наиболее прост. В этом случае можно воспользоваться документом Начисление зарплаты и взносов или специализированным документом Перерасчет прошлых периодов, если начисления уже были зафиксированы.

Для исправления ситуации необходимо ввести документ, который сторнирует (отменяет) лишнюю часть начисления. В интерфейсе программы это делается через создание нового начисления с отрицательным значением или использованием механизма «Исправление в текущем месяце». Система автоматически пересчитает базу для НДФЛ и страховых взносов, если вы используете актуальные релизы конфигурации.

Убедитесь, что в документе исправления указан верный вид расчета. Часто бухгалтеры забывают скорректировать сопутствующие начисления, такие как районный коэффициент или северная надбавка, которые рассчитываются пропорционально окладу. Если этого не сделать, возникнет расхождение между фактической выплатой и данными в регистрах.

💡

Всегда проверяйте вкладку «Сотрудники» в документе начисления после внесения исправлений. Убедитесь, что итоговая сумма к выплату стала корректной и не ушла в минус.

После проведения корректирующего документа следует заново сформировать ведомость на выплату. Если деньги уже были перечислены на карты, разница будет числиться за сотрудником как переплата (дебетовое сальдо по счету расчетов с персоналом). Эту сумму можно удержать при следующей выплате, оформив соответствующее заявление.

Возврат через кассу или банк в следующем периоде

Наиболее распространенная ситуация — переплата обнаружена уже после того, как месяц закрыт, отчеты сданы, а деньги ушли сотруднику. В этом случае в 1С:ЗУП используется механизм возврата средств. Сотрудник может внести деньги в кассу организации или перевести их на расчетный счет.

Для отражения поступления денег используется документ Прочее поступление или специализированный документ Возврат излишне выплаченной зарплаты (в зависимости от версии и настроек интерфейса). Критически важно правильно указать статью денежных потоков и счет расчетов. Обычно используется счет 70 «Расчеты с персоналом по оплате труда».

При вводе документа необходимо указать:

  • 👤 Физическое лицо, вернувшее средства.
  • 💰 Сумму возврата (полностью или частично).
  • 📅 Дату фактического поступления денег.
  • 📝 Основание платежа (например, «Возврат переплаты за январь 2026»).

⚠️ Внимание: При внесении наличных в кассу обязательно оформите приходный кассовый ордер (ПКО). В 1С это можно сделать на основании документа поступления, выбрав опцию «Создать ПКО».

После проведения документа в карточке счета 70 у сотрудника образуется кредитовое сальдо (если переплата была погашена) или уменьшится дебетовое сальдо. Однако этот документ сам по себе не уменьшает базу НДФЛ прошлого периода. Налог, удержанный излишне, придется корректировать отдельно, если он был перечислен в бюджет.

☑️ Оформление возврата денег

Выполнено: 0 / 4

Сторнирование начислений и корректировка НДФЛ

Самый сложный этап — работа с налогом на доходы физических лиц. Если вы сторнировали начисление зарплаты, база для НДФЛ уменьшилась. Это значит, что налог, удержанный ранее, стал излишним. В 1С ЗУП есть несколько способов урегулировать эту разницу.

Если ошибка найдена в том же году, можно воспользоваться документом Перерасчет НДФЛ или скорректировать данные в регистре накопления «НДФЛ к перечислению». Программа позволяет зачесть излишне удержанный налог в счет будущих платежей по этому же сотруднику. Для этого в документе начисления зарплаты в следующем месяце нужно проверить флаги учета переплаты по налогу.

В случае, когда возврат производится в следующем году, ситуация усложняется. Вам придется подавать уточненную справку 2-НДФЛ и корректировать расчет 6-НДФЛ. В программе 1С для этого используется механизм корректировки регистра сведений. Необходимо найти запись о доходе за прошлый период и уменьшить сумму дохода и сумму налога.

Ситуация Действие в 1С Влияние на отчетность
Ошибка в текущем месяце Сторнирование начисления Отчеты формируются верно автоматически
Ошибка в прошлом месяце (тот же год) Возврат денег + Зачет НДФЛ Требуется проверка 6-НДФЛ
Ошибка в прошлом году Возврат денег + Коррекция регистров Уточненная 2-НДФЛ и 6-НДФЛ
Техническая переплата (счетная ошибка) Удержание из зарплаты Зависит от периода удержания

⚠️ Внимание: Интерфейс и названия документов могут отличаться в зависимости от версии релиза 1С ЗУП (3.1.10, 3.1.20 и т.д.). Всегда сверяйтесь с актуальной документацией к вашей конфигурации перед проведением операций с налогами.

Как работает автоматический зачет НДФЛ?

При сторнировании начисления программа фиксирует «отрицательный» налог. В следующем месяце при расчете зарплаты система автоматически уменьшит сумму налога к удержанию на величину этой переплаты, если включена соответствующая настройка в параметрах учета.

Удержание из следующей заработной платы

Если сотрудник согласен вернуть деньги путем удержания из будущей зарплаты, в 1С:ЗУП это оформляется максимально просто. Вам не нужно создавать лишних документов поступления, достаточно правильно настроить документ Начисление зарплаты за следующий месяц.

В документе начисления, на вкладке «Удержания» или в специальном разделе «Возврат переплаты», следует добавить сумму, подлежащую удержанию. Программа сама проверит ограничение: по закону (ст. 138 ТК РФ) общий размер всех удержаний не может превышать 20% от суммы, причитающейся к выплате (в отдельных случаях 50% или 70%).

Если сумма переплаты велика и превышает лимит в 20%, удержание придется производить частями в течение нескольких месяцев. В 1С это контролируется автоматически: если вы попытаетесь удержать больше положенного, система выдаст предупреждение или не проведет сумму полностью. В таком случае остаток переносится на следующий месяц.

💡

Автоматическое удержание возможно только при наличии достаточной суммы начислений в текущем месяце. Если сотрудник был в отпуске без содержания, удержать долг не получится — потребуется внесение наличных.

Важно отметить, что при удержании из зарплаты НДФЛ не пересчитывается задним числом, если начисление прошлого месяца было верным с точки зрения отработанного времени, а переплата возникла по иной причине (например, премия начислена дважды). В этом случае удерживается «чистая» сумма долга.

Отражение операций в бухгалтерском учете (1С:Бухгалтерия)

Часто пользователи работают в связке 1С:ЗУП и 1С:Бухгалтерия предприятия. Важно, чтобы операции возврата зарплаты корректно отразились в бухгалтерском учете. При использовании типового обмена данными документы, созданные в ЗУП, должны выгружаться в Бухгалтерию.

Документ Возврат излишне выплаченной зарплаты или Прочее поступление формирует проводки по дебету счета 50 (Касса) или 51 (Расчетный счет) и кредиту счета 70. Если вы используете удержание из зарплаты, то в месяце удержания проводки формируются автоматически при проведении ведомости: Дт 70 Кт 70 (внутренний зачет) или Дт 70 Кт 91 (если это признано прочим доходом, что редко для зарплаты).

При выгрузке в 1С:Бухгалтерию проверьте соответствие счетов учета. Иногда требуется ручная донастройка плана счетов, если в организации используются субсчета для аналитики переплат. Ошибки в проводках могут привести к неверному формированию баланса и отчета о движении денежных средств.

Основные проводки при возврате:

  • 📒 Дт 50 (51) Кт 70 — возврат переплаты наличными или на расчетный счет.
  • 📒 Дт 70 Кт 50 (51) — сторнирование излишней выплаты (если выплата еще не ушла в банк/кассу).
  • 📒 Дт 70 Кт 68.01 — корректировка НДФЛ (при сторнировании начисления).
Что делать, если обмен не прошел?

Проверьте журнал регистрации обмена в обеих базах. Часто проблема кроется в несоответствии версий конфигураций или блокировке объекта пользователем в момент выгрузки.

Частые ошибки и способы их предотвращения

При работе с возвратом зарплаты бухгалтеры часто допускают типичные ошибки, которые приводят к «разносу» в регистрах 1С. Одна из самых частых проблем — двойное отражение операции. Пользователь сначала делает сторно начисления, а потом еще и вводит документ возврата денег, считая, что сторно не аннулирует долг.

Еще одна ошибка — игнорирование НДФЛ. Сторнируя зарплату, многие забывают, что налог тоже должен быть сторнирован. В результате в карточке расчетов с бюджетом висит переплата по налогу, которую сложно объяснить при камеральной проверке. Всегда используйте отчет Анализ НДФЛ после любых операций корректировки.

Также стоит упомянуть ошибку при выборе вида операции в документе поступления. Если выбрать «Прочее поступление» без указания конкретного вида расчета, программа может не связать эту сумму с зарплатным проектом, и она повиснет в подвешенном состоянии, не закрывая долг по 70 счету.

⚠️ Внимание: Никогда не удаляйте документы начисления зарплаты за закрытые периоды, если в них уже были произведены выплаты. Это нарушит целостность истории расчетов. Используйте только документы корректировки и сторнирования.

Регулярная сверка данных между 1С:ЗУП, банковской выпиской и данными бухгалтерского учета поможет избежать накопления ошибок. Используйте стандартные отчеты «Ведомость по расчетам с персоналом» для контроля сальдо по каждому сотруднику.

💡

Перед массовым исправлением ошибок за прошлый период сделайте резервную копию базы данных (файл .dtb). Это позволит быстро откатиться, если корректировки приведут к непредвиденным искажениям данных.

FAQ: Вопросы и ответы

Можно ли удержать переплату без согласия сотрудника?

Без согласия сотрудника удержание возможно только в случае счетной ошибки (арифметической) или если есть заключение комиссии по трудовым спорам. Ошибка в применении закона или неверное толкование норм не считается счетной ошибкой. В 1С это контролируется слабо, ответственность лежит на работодателе.

Как отразить возврат, если сотрудник уволился?

Если сотрудник уволился и не вернул переплату добровольно, организация может обратиться в суд. В 1С долг остается висеть на 70 счете с дебетовым сальдо. При истечении срока исковой давности сумма списывается на прочие расходы (счет 91.2), но это требует тщательного документального оформления.

Нужно ли подавать уточненку по 6-НДФЛ при возврате?

Да, если возврат влияет на суммы налога, удержанного в предыдущем отчетном периоде. При сторнировании начисления база уменьшается, значит, налог должен быть пересчитан. Если переплата возвращена в том же периоде, возможно, уточненка не потребуется, но это зависит от дат фактического получения дохода.

Какой документ использовать: «Перерасчет» или «Сторно»?

В современных версиях 1С ЗУП 3.1 лучше использовать документ «Перерасчет прошлых периодов» или функцию «Исправление в текущем месяце» внутри начисления. Прямое сторно документов прошлого периода («Сторнирование записи») используется реже и требует большей осторожности, так как может пересчитать все регистры заново.

Что делать, если 1С не дает удержать больше 20%?

Это ограничение установлено Трудовым кодексом и жестко вшито в логику программы. Обойти его в документе начисления нельзя. Единственный легальный способ вернуть остальное — добровольное внесение денег сотрудником через кассу или на счет организации отдельным платежом.